Creating Test Scripts in Selenium
Selenium is one of the most popular open-source tools for automating web application testing. It supports multiple programming languages like Java, Python, C#, and works with major browsers including Chrome, Firefox, and Edge. Creating test scripts in Selenium enables QA engineers to simulate real user interactions, validate application behavior, and ensure software quality efficiently.
What is a Selenium Test Script?
A Selenium test script is a piece of code written to perform specific actions on a web page — such as clicking a button, entering text, verifying elements, or navigating between pages — just as a real user would do. These scripts can be used for functional, regression, and smoke testing.
Getting Started: Tools and Setup
Install Java or Python (depending on your language of choice).
Download Selenium WebDriver for your browser.
Set up your IDE (Eclipse for Java, PyCharm/VS Code for Python).
Add Selenium libraries to your project.
For Java (Maven):
<dependency>
<groupId>org.seleniumhq.selenium</groupId>
<artifactId>selenium-java</artifactId>
<version>4.18.0</version>
</dependency>
For Python:
pip install selenium
Example: Basic Selenium Test Script (Python)
from selenium import webdriver
from selenium.webdriver.common.by import By
driver = webdriver.Chrome()
driver.get("https://example.com")
# Locate input field and enter text
driver.find_element(By.NAME, "username").send_keys("testuser")
# Click login button
driver.find_element(By.ID, "loginBtn").click()
# Verify page title
assert "Dashboard" in driver.title
driver.quit()
This script opens a website, enters login credentials, clicks a button, and checks if the login was successful.
Best Practices for Writing Selenium Scripts
Use Page Object Model (POM) to organize test code and improve maintainability.
Implement explicit waits to handle dynamic content:
from selenium.webdriver.support.ui import WebDriverWait
WebDriverWait(driver, 10).until(lambda d: d.title == "Dashboard")
Use assertions to validate test outcomes.
Maintain a test data strategy using data files or parameters.
